Demi Lovato: Former Boyfriend Wilmer Valderrama Visits Singer in Hospital
Valderrama, who dated Lovato on and off for six years, was seen looking somber outside Cedars-Sinai Medical Center.
Demi Lovato’s ex-boyfriend, Wilmer Valderrama, has been photographed rushing to her hospital bedside following her overdose.
The "NCIS" actor, driving a black Tesla, was seen speeding into a staff parking lot at Cedars-Sinai Medical Center in Los Angeles Wednesday.
He spent two full hours comforting Lovato and left looking somber. He refused to answer questions from photographers.
Valderrama and the singer dated on and off for six years. When they split up for good in 2016, Lovato’s mom said it "broke us all,” according to People magazine.
Lovato’s family wants the singer to check into a rehab outside Los Angeles as soon as she is discharged from the hospital. That could be as early as Thursday.
Addiction specialist Dr. Kevin Gilliland says the 25-year-old singer is at a crossroads.
“What they'll start to talk about and map out especially in this first week or two is, 'How do we get back on that path?' and what is really critical is the next 90 days," he told Inside Edition.
The "Skyscraper" singer is "grateful to be alive" after her brush with death but doubts are being raised about whether she really wants to go back to rehab, People Magazine Music Editor Janine Rubenstein said.
"Sources closes to Demi Lovato have told us that they are actually worried for her now because this may not be her rock bottom, as they say," she told Inside Edition.
Meanwhile, more details are emerging about the wild bash that led to Lovato's overdose. The singer started at a nightclub before partying the rest of the night at her home.
When paramedics responded to an emergency call, they reportedly found drugs and drug paraphernalia scattered around the residence.
